Abstract :
A theory for an all-superconducting electric generator is developed based on Maxwell´s equations. The theory differs in some respects from that for a normal generator. The result is applied to a generator with an armature winding made from coated conductors. The theory emphasizes the importance of surface charge on the superconductor.
